Testing task: Bump into the bottom edge of a Nested modal dialog

With NVDA in browse mode on mode, describe how NVDA behaves when performing task "Starting at the 'Your Profile' link inside the nested dialog, navigate to the bottom of the dialog and make multiple attempts to navigate past the bottom edge."

Test instructions

  1. Restore default settings for NVDA. For help, read Configuring Screen Readers for Testing.
  2. Activate the "Open test page" button below, which opens the example to test in a new window and runs a script that opens the 'Add Delivery Address' dialog followed by the 'Address Added' dialog, and sets focus on the 'your profile' link inside the second dialog.
  3. Press Insert+Space. If NVDA made the focus mode sound, press Insert+Space again to turn browse mode back on.
  4. Starting at the 'Your Profile' link inside the nested dialog, navigate to the bottom of the dialog and make multiple attempts to navigate past the bottom edge.
  5. Using the following commands, Starting at the 'Your Profile' link inside the nested dialog, navigate to the bottom of the dialog and make multiple attempts to navigate past the bottom edge.
    • Control+End then Down Arrow then Down Arrow then Insert+Up Arrow (browse mode on)

Success Criteria

To pass this test, NVDA needs to meet all the following assertions when each specified command is executed:

  1. The browse mode caret is positioned at 'OK' button
